Factors Affecting Cost

  • Material Quality: Higher quality gravel may cost more but ensures durability.
  • Road Length: Longer roads require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
  • Terrain Type: Hilly or uneven terrains can complicate construction, leading to higher expenses.
  •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Richland, WA, can vary, impacting the total cost.
  •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local regulations may require additional permits and fees.
  • Drainage Requirements: Proper drainage solutions can add to the cost but are essential for road longevity.
  • Equipment Rental: Renting specialized construction equipment can be a significant expense.
  • Base Preparation: Properly preparing the base layer is crucial and can affect costs.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Richland, WA)
Gravel Material (per ton) $20 - $50
Grading and Leveling (per mile) $5,000 - $15,000
Drainage Installation (per mile) $3,000 - $8,000
Base Layer Preparation (per mile) $4,000 - $10,000
Equipment Rental (per day) $200 - $600
Labor (per hour) $50 - $100
Permits and Fees $500 - $2,000
